PLEASE READ THE FOLLOWING BEFORE ANSWERING THE NEXT QUESTIONS:
“Conviction” for this application, means a final judgment or verdict of guilty, a plea of guilty, or a plea of non contendere, in any state or federal court, regardless of whether an appeal is pending or could be taken. “Conviction” does not include a final judgment or verdict that has been expunged by pardon, reversed, set aside or otherwise rendered invalid. Further, you are not required to disclose any arrest(s), criminal charge(s) or conviction(s), the record(s) of which have been erased under the law. Such records can include records of a finding of delinquency or that a child was a member of a family with service needs, adjudication of youthful offender status, criminal charges dismissed or nolled, or charges for which a person is found not guilty, or a conviction later resulting in an absolute pardon. Further, any person whose criminal records have been erased is deemed under law never to have been arrested with respect to such erased proceedings and may so swear under oath. A history of criminal conviction(s) will not necessarily bar consideration of employment. Factors such as the time, seriousness and nature of the offense, as well as rehabilitation, will be taken into account. Should you have any questions about answering questions on this application, or your rights concerning erased records, please contact Human Resources.

STATEMENT OF FAITH
The following statement is reaffirmed annually by all the members of the Faculty and Staff at The Master’s School and represents our commitment to faith.

We believe that there is one God, eternally existent in three persons: Father, Son, and Holy Spirit. We believe in the deity of Jesus Christ, His virgin birth, His sinless life, His miracles, His vicarious and atoning death through His shed blood, His bodily resurrection, His ascension to the right hand of the Father, and His personal return in power and glory. We believe the Bible to be the inspired, the only infallible, authoritative Word of God. We believe that for the salvation of lost and sinful man regeneration by the Holy Spirit is absolutely essential. We believe in the present ministry of the Holy Spirit by whose indwelling the Christian is enabled to live a godly life. We believe in the resurrection of both the saved and the lost, they who are saved unto the resurrection of life and they who are lost unto the resurrection of damnation. We believe in the spiritual unity of believers in our Lord Jesus Christ.

The Master’s School is an independent, college-preparatory, non-denominational Christian day school enrolling children in preschool through post-graduate in West Simsbury, CT.

The Master's School is fully accredited by New England Association of Schools and Colleges (NEASC).

The Master's School opens its doors to all qualified students regardless of race, color, national or ethnic origin, or religious affiliation. It does not discriminate on the basis of race, color, or national affiliation in the administration of its educational policies, admissions policies, financial aid, and other school-administered programs.
